Output fd2d21d6839157b97c23e26567a08da3606d3797caa73a4958d4b092017058a5:19

value
137034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584b63c2031ff51dfb786c98fe01eb5fa598ebaa OP_EQUAL
address
39jshbGHp26ThqdaSTZnz3hYCNJL2xsqso
transaction
fd2d21d6839157b97c23e26567a08da3606d3797caa73a4958d4b092017058a5
spent
true